Huge change to QR code check-in system for businesses across NSW

NSW health minister Brad Hazard has announced a huge change to the sign-in system for businesses across the state.As of January 1, every business must have a Service NSW QR code with those who fail to do so facing a hefty fine.
“I want to stress that you have a quieter period right now to get on to doing that and you need to do it,” Mr Hazard said on Monday.
